This study aims to collect demographic and medical information including detailed family history of cancer of children and adolescents with adrenocortical tumors in order to learn more about the clinical and epidemiological aspects, treatment modalities, and outcome of patients with this rare disease, worldwide. In addition, investigators at St. Jude Children's Research Hospital (SJCRH) plan to perform molecular studies of tumor cells aimed to clarify the role of the TP53 gene and other genetic pathways in these tumors. They aim to obtain relevant biological material from participants with adrenocortical tumor (ACT), their biological parents, and relatives for determination of the TP53 germline status, molecular studies of the TP53 gene, and other molecular pathways.
Adrenocortical tumors (ACT) are rare cancer types that form in the outer layer of the adrenal gland and are very uncommon in children and teenagers. There is variation in pediatric ACT incidence worldwide. In the United States, only about 25 new cases of ACT per million per year, making this a very rare tumor. However, in southern Brazil, the annual incidence of ACT is 15 times that seen in the United States accounting for 3.4-4.2 per million per year.
